Ansar al-Sunnah Claims Northern Iraq Blast


A suicide bomber has killed at least 50 people and wounded 100 others in an attack on police recruits in the northern Iraqi city of Irbil. The militant group Ansar al-Sunnah claimed responsibility on its website for Wednesday's blast, saying it was in retaliation for Kurdish cooperation with U.S. and coalition forces. Another car bomb attack killed nine Iraqi troops in Baghdad Wednesday. More than 200 people have died in insurgent attacks over the last week. Rebels increased attacks after Prime Minister Ibrahim al-Jaafari announced a partial cabinet last week. Meanwhile, the U.S. military says it found the body of a second American pilot missing since two jets disappeared over Iraq this week. Authorities are still trying to determine what caused the jets to crash.
